How to Dump Someone and Stay Friends

Have you dealt with the psycho ex-boyfriends or ex-girlfriends? Do you still want to be friends with your ex. Here is how to break up and avoid much of the pain associated with break-ups.

Instructions

    • 1

      The first thing is to adjust your attitude. Do not feel sorry for the person or think that you are ruining their day. Realize that you are giving them the gift of freedom and the time to find their true love.

    • 2

      Next make sure that you do it as soon as you have the inkling. If you are even thinking about breaking up with someone, chances are they are not right for you. Why drag it on and waste your time and theirs.

    • 3

      Next keep the breakup short. Have a short 10 work sentence and then leave them alone to sort through their feelings. The longer they are with you, the tougher it will be and more likely they will cry and loose face. You want them to be able to keep their dignity.

    • 4

      Now make sure that in the breakup you are completely honest. Do not use clichés or sugar coat things. Tell them exactly why you are breaking up.

    • 5

      Last but not least set up break up rules. Let them know how long until you will talk to them. Make sure you give them at least a couple weeks this will eliminate the drunk calls and other embarrassing things that could happen.

Tips & Warnings

  • Be patient, sometimes emotions go crazy and he may act psycho for a bit. Give him time to come around.
